    February 7, 2022 - Got this with the wine club when I was a member...tough to see it on garagiste closeout for less than half the wineclub price. I wish that didn't influence my judgement. On the nose: blackberry, bramble, dark spice, cassis. On the palate: excellent acidity, a touch thin; the palate is much less dense than the nose suggests, soft tannin on the finish. Still very primary, but in a good place.
